April 2026 Weather Report for Henegouwen, Belgium
April 2026 brought notably warmer and significantly drier conditions to the province of Henegouwen compared to historical averages. The month was characterized by above-normal temperatures, exceptional sunshine, and remarkably low precipitation levels that deviated sharply from typical spring weather patterns.
Temperature Overview
The average temperature for April reached 11.1 degrees Celsius, exceeding the normal value of 9.9 degrees by 1.2 degrees. This positive anomaly reflects a warmer-than-average month across the province. The warmest day occurred on April 9 in Tournai, where temperatures climbed to 24.9 degrees Celsius, providing a taste of early summer warmth. In contrast, the coldest reading was recorded on April 3 in Ham-sur-Heure-Nalinnes, dipping to -0.6 degrees Celsius, indicating frost conditions during the early part of the month.
Precipitation Patterns
April 2026 was exceptionally dry, with an average total precipitation of just 14.3 millimeters across the province. This represents a dramatic 77 percent decrease from the normal April precipitation of 62.5 millimeters. The wettest day occurred on April 13 in Pecq, where 18.6 millimeters fell, accounting for a substantial portion of the month's total rainfall. Pecq emerged as the wettest location overall, accumulating 30.3 millimeters for the entire month, yet this still remained well below seasonal expectations.
Sunshine and Notable Features
Sunshine hours totaled 293.4 hours, surpassing the normal value of 265.1 hours by 11 percent. This above-average sunshine contributed to the warmer temperatures and dry conditions experienced throughout the month.
